Essential Maintenance Recommendations

Adhering to a consistent maintenance schedule optimizes vehicle performance and longevity. The following recommendations offer guidance on maintaining vital vehicle components.

Tip 1: Tire Pressure Monitoring: Regularly check and maintain optimal tire pressure. Under- or over-inflated tires can lead to decreased fuel efficiency, uneven wear, and compromised handling.

Tip 2: Tire Rotation and Balancing: Implement scheduled tire rotation and balancing. This practice promotes even wear across all tires, extending their lifespan and ensuring a smoother ride.

Tip 3: Tread Depth Inspection: Routinely inspect tire tread depth. Insufficient tread depth compromises traction, particularly in wet or snowy conditions, increasing the risk of accidents.

Tip 4: Exhaust System Examination: Conduct periodic exhaust system inspections. Corrosion, leaks, or damage can lead to reduced engine performance, increased emissions, and potential safety hazards.

Tip 5: Muffler Integrity: Ensure the muffler is free from damage and properly secured. A compromised muffler can result in excessive noise, potentially violating local regulations, and reduced exhaust system efficiency.

Tip 6: Professional Inspections: Schedule regular professional inspections by qualified technicians. They possess the expertise to identify and address potential issues before they escalate into costly repairs.

Tip 7: Prompt Repairs: Address any identified issues promptly. Delaying repairs can lead to further damage, increased repair costs, and potential vehicle downtime.

Implementing these maintenance practices can significantly enhance vehicle reliability, reduce operational expenses, and ensure compliance with safety standards.

1. Tire Pressure

1. Tire Pressure, Tire

Tire pressure management is a fundamental aspect of commercial vehicle maintenance, directly impacting the efficiency, safety, and longevity of vehicles serviced by entities such as “alice commercial tire and muffler service.” Maintaining correct tire pressure is not merely a routine check but a critical factor influencing operational costs and regulatory compliance.

  • Fuel Efficiency

    Optimal tire pressure minimizes rolling resistance, translating directly into improved fuel economy. Underinflated tires increase the contact area with the road, requiring more energy to propel the vehicle. For commercial fleets, even a small improvement in fuel efficiency can result in significant cost savings over time. “Alice commercial tire and muffler service” can play a vital role in ensuring fleets adhere to pressure standards.

  • Tire Wear

    Incorrect tire pressure leads to uneven and accelerated tire wear. Underinflation causes the outer edges of the tire to wear prematurely, while overinflation concentrates wear in the center. Regular pressure checks and adjustments conducted by “alice commercial tire and muffler service” can significantly extend tire lifespan, reducing the frequency and cost of replacements.

  • Handling and Safety

    Proper tire pressure ensures optimal handling and stability, especially under heavy loads or during challenging driving conditions. Underinflated tires can lead to reduced steering responsiveness and increased risk of tire failure, particularly at high speeds. “Alice commercial tire and muffler service” contributes to road safety by helping ensure commercial vehicles maintain appropriate tire pressure for their operating conditions.

  • Load Capacity

    Each tire has a maximum load capacity rating that is directly tied to its inflation pressure. Operating tires at pressures below the recommended level reduces their load-carrying capacity, potentially leading to tire failure and compromising vehicle safety. “Alice commercial tire and muffler service” helps ensure that vehicles are operating within safe load limits by properly inflating tires to meet the demands of their cargo.

These facets underscore the importance of diligent tire pressure management within commercial fleet operations. Services offered by “alice commercial tire and muffler service,” such as regular pressure checks, inflation adjustments, and tire condition assessments, are essential for optimizing vehicle performance, enhancing safety, and minimizing operational expenses.

2. Tread Depth

2. Tread Depth, Tire

Tread depth is a critical safety factor directly impacting vehicle handling, particularly in adverse weather conditions. The degree to which a tire’s tread is worn significantly affects its ability to maintain contact with the road surface, especially when encountering water, snow, or ice. Insufficient tread depth increases the risk of hydroplaning, skidding, and longer stopping distances. Regular assessment and maintenance of tread depth by service providers like “alice commercial tire and muffler service” are therefore essential for ensuring vehicle safety and preventing accidents. For example, a delivery truck with worn tires traveling on a wet road requires substantially more distance to stop safely than one with adequate tread depth.

Frequently Asked Questions

This section addresses common inquiries regarding commercial tire and muffler maintenance services, providing clarity on key aspects of vehicle upkeep and regulatory compliance.

Question 1: What constitutes a commercial vehicle for service eligibility?

A commercial vehicle encompasses any vehicle used for business purposes, including but not limited to delivery trucks, vans, and fleet vehicles. Vehicle classification is determined by usage rather than vehicle type.

Question 2: What is the recommended tire pressure for commercial vehicles?

Recommended tire pressure varies based on vehicle type, load, and tire specifications. Consult the vehicle’s tire placard or owner’s manual for specific guidance. Adherence to recommended pressure enhances fuel efficiency and safety.

Question 3: How frequently should commercial vehicle tires be inspected?

Commercial vehicle tires require routine inspection, ideally before each trip and at least weekly. Inspections should encompass tire pressure, tread depth, and the presence of cuts, bulges, or other damage.

Question 4: What are the indicators of a failing muffler?

Indicators of a failing muffler include excessive noise, rust, physical damage, and decreased engine performance. Prompt replacement prevents further damage and ensures regulatory compliance.

Question 5: What is the minimum legal tread depth for commercial vehicle tires?

The minimum legal tread depth for commercial vehicle tires is typically 2/32 of an inch. Tires with tread depth below this threshold are considered unsafe and illegal for operation.

Question 6: Why is preventative maintenance crucial for commercial vehicles?

Preventative maintenance minimizes downtime, extends vehicle lifespan, and reduces overall operational costs. Scheduled maintenance addresses minor issues before they escalate into major repairs, ensuring vehicle reliability.
